Daily Maintenance Items for CNC Hydraulic Punching Machine (1)
Regularly check whether the safety measures of the equipment are effective. The "emergency stop" buttons of the CNC hydraulic punching machine are mechanically locked and must be rotated to reset. To start the machine, all emergency stop buttons must be reset.
Check daily for any leaks in the hydraulic and pneumatic lines, ensure the pressure is normal, and verify that the water cooling system is functioning well. Inspect the outer layer of high-pressure hoses for integrity and check for any signs of detachment near the joints. Replace them promptly if necessary to avoid cracking.
The oil used in the CNC hydraulic punching machine must be strictly filtered before being added to the oil tank. The oil level in the tank should not be lower than the mark on the oil gauge.
The oil temperature must never exceed 50℃, otherwise, the system will be damaged. For equipment that is not used for an extended period, the piston rod of the oil cylinder must be retracted into the cylinder to prevent rust.
Listen weekly to the operating sounds of the motor, pipelines, solenoid valves, and oil tank to ensure they are normal.
Inspect the water separator filter, lubricator, pressure regulator, and pressure gauge weekly. Calibrate and check the pressure gauge every six months.
